Lindisfarne — Fog On The Tyne 1971 (UK, Progressive Folk)<br /><br /><br />Their second album was a breakthrough for Lindisfarne in the UK: in early 1972, the band topped the UK album chart for four weeks and remained there for a total of 56 weeks.Fog on the Tyne is a 1971 album by English rock band Lindisfarne. Bob Johnston produced the album, which was recorded at Trident Studios in Soho, London, in mid 1971 and released in October that year on Charisma Records in the U.K. and Elektra Records in the U.S.<br /><br />It gave the group their breakthrough in the U.K., topping the UK Albums Chart early in 1972 for four weeks and remaining on the chart for 56 weeks in total. "Meet Me on the Corner", one of two songs written by bassist Rod Clements, reached No. 5 as a single. The title track became the band's signature tune. Simon Cowe made his debut as a writer, contributing the song "Uncle Sam".<br /><br />Both tracks on the B-side of "Meet Me on the Corner", "Scotch Mist" (an instrumental), and "No Time To Lose", appeared as bonus tracks when the album was reissued .<br /><br />A heavily reworked version of the title track, with vocals by footballer Paul Gascoigne, was released on 29 October 1990 under the title "Fog on the Tyne (Revisited)", credited to Gazza and Lindisfarne.[5]It reached number two on the UK singles chart.<br /><br />Reggae group The Pioneers recorded a version of "Alright on the Night" on their 1972 album I Believe in Love.<br /><br />Tracks:<br /><br />01.
